Transaction d5592d86fca16778f77ab28c190edfdcf5df73fa539ff1d26d674153b7d58cfd

1 Input
2 Outputs
  • d5592d86fca16778f77ab28c190edfdcf5df73fa539ff1d26d674153b7d58cfd:0
  • value  1017000
    address  3Fi2H4gRvi9pMD4X23ykuHXfgrivqLwzrA
  • d5592d86fca16778f77ab28c190edfdcf5df73fa539ff1d26d674153b7d58cfd:1
  • value  7071767
    address  17ehhqmEvLEPgYhH6YWR4VenJddWT5Hmcv